Commit fca4cef2 authored by Jie Yuan's avatar Jie Yuan
Browse files

add dashboard module

parent 820df1ca
Loading
Loading
Loading
Loading
+64 −0
Original line number Diff line number Diff line
import { NgModule } from '@angular/core';
import { Routes, RouterModule } from '@angular/router';

import { CommonModule } from '@angular/common';
import { TableComponent } from './table/table.component';


import {MatTableModule} from '@angular/material/table'; 
import {MatPaginatorModule} from '@angular/material/paginator'; 
import {MatSortModule} from '@angular/material/sort'; 
import {MatSidenavModule} from '@angular/material/sidenav'; 
import {MatToolbarModule} from '@angular/material/toolbar'; 
import {MatIconModule} from '@angular/material/icon'; 
import {LayoutModule} from '@angular/cdk/layout'; 
import {MatListModule} from '@angular/material/list'; 
import {MatMenuModule} from '@angular/material/menu';
import {MatSelectModule} from '@angular/material/select';
import {MatGridListModule} from '@angular/material/grid-list'; 
import {MatCardModule} from '@angular/material/card'; 
import {MatTooltipModule} from '@angular/material/tooltip'; 
import {MatFormFieldModule} from '@angular/material/form-field';
import {MatInputModule} from '@angular/material/input'; 
import { FormsModule , ReactiveFormsModule} from '@angular/forms';

import {AuthGuard} from './auth-guard.service';
import { FulltableComponent } from './fulltable/fulltable.component';
import { HostnameComponent } from './hostname/hostname.component';
import { SiteComponent } from './site/site.component';
import { ServiceComponentComponent } from './service-component/service-component.component';
import { ServiceComponentHistoryComponent } from './service-component-history/service-component-history.component';


export const SINGLETON_SERVICES = [
  AuthGuard

];


@NgModule({
  declarations: [TableComponent,, 
    FulltableComponent, HostnameComponent, SiteComponent, ServiceComponentComponent, ServiceComponentHistoryComponent ],
  imports: [
    CommonModule,
    RouterModule,
    MatTableModule,
    MatPaginatorModule,
    MatSortModule,
    MatSidenavModule,
    MatToolbarModule,
    MatIconModule,
    LayoutModule,
    MatListModule,
    MatMenuModule,
    MatSelectModule,
    MatGridListModule,
    MatCardModule,
    MatTooltipModule,
    MatFormFieldModule,
    MatInputModule,
    FormsModule,
    ReactiveFormsModule
  ]
})
export class DashboardModule { }